Existing nationwide data to define the accessibility of non-standard care options are doing not have. The number of day care rooms readily available to meet the requirements of Canadian kids is seriously important information for families, provider and plan manufacturers. The report Early Youth Education and learning and Treatment in copyright, 2019 (Friendly et al., 2020) approximated that there were 1.5 million accredited kid treatment rooms for youngsters aged 0 to 12 years in 2019, a rise of about 156,000 areas considering that 2016.


Really little details is offered to describe the features of kids making use of certified day care, such as their socioeconomic condition, Native or immigrant identification, and handicap status. One column of the Multilateral Early Discovering and Childcare Framework is the provision of inclusive look after children of all histories and capabilities.

Extremely little details is readily available to define youngster treatment usage amongst youngsters with impairments, although a forthcoming Statistics copyright pilot survey will catch parent-reported info on day care use and barriers for this population. At the service arrangement degree, some provinces and territories capture management details relevant to the stipulation of assistance services within day care (see Friendly et al.


It is essential to think about not just the number of children with handicaps who are registered, however likewise the extent to which centres have plans, methods and sustains to make certain high quality and inclusion (Irwin & Lero, 2021). A household's capacity to pay for and make use of youngster care is mainly figured out by the amount charged by the childcare supplier for the solution.

Charges are mostly market driven, with typical fees for infants ranging from $189 each month across the province of Quebec to $1,948 in Toronto in 2021 (Macdonald & Friendly, 2022) (daycare near me). Unlike other Canadian jurisdictions, the Quebec government provides a minimized payment program for youngsters aged 0 to 5 years enlisted in CPEs and for-profit centres (garderies)


Furthermore, greater salaries are very important to attract and retain qualified personnel and to minimize team turnover (Flanagan, Beach, & Varmuza, 2013; Friendly, 2019). Up-to-date information on staffing levels, qualifications and salaries is important for notifying childcare labor force techniques that intend to raise employment and retention of experienced very early childhood years teachers.


In the very first few months of the pandemic, many jurisdictions mandated a short-lived closure of childcare centres and institutions andin some districts and territoriesfamily child care homes. Around 72% of centres had actually closed since April or Might 2020, with the majority of various other centres remaining open only to give treatment to the children of crucial employees (Friendly, Forer, Vickerson, & Mohamed, 2021).


Even into 2021, 73% of centres reported that enrolment was somewhat or much lower than pre-pandemic degrees (Vickerson, Friendly, Forer, Mohamed, & Nguyen, 2022). Plainly, the COVID-19 pandemic has interfered with the stipulation of day care services in copyright. Outcomes from the Canadian Study on the Provision of Day Care Services (CSPCCS) supply a means to check out the state of childcare in very early 2022.

The 2022 CSPCCS is a cross-sectional study carried out by Data copyright in partnership with Employment and Social Development copyright (Data copyright, 2022c). The CSPCCS supplies a picture of youngster treatment services in copyright for youngsters aged 12 and more youthful at the national, provincial and territorial degrees. Data were accumulated making use of a digital set of questions, with telephone follow-up to finish full or partial non-response cases.





The target populace was centre-based childcare companies and certified and unlicensed home-based child treatment companies. The survey structure was built based upon (1) businesses recognized as youngster day-care solutions (North American Market Classification System [NAICS] code 62441) on Statistics copyright's Business Register as of February 2022 that reported at the very least $2,500 in annual income and (2) publicly available rural and territorial listings of qualified childcare suppliers.


An example of 20,000 day care centres was picked, with a reaction rate of 42%Tasting was stratified by the probability of remaining in among the 3 sorts of youngster care (centre, certified home-based and unlicensed home-based) and by province or territorial region. childcare centre near me. Auxiliary information associated to work and income was utilized to forecast childcare type

For the purpose of this record, just youngster care centres that supplied treatment to youngsters aged 5 years and younger and that did not only offer treatment to school-aged children were taken into consideration (n = 3,306). Day care drivers or supervisors provided info on solutions supplied, kid enrolment, personnel, credentials and pay on April 6, 2022.

As guidelines connected to age teams vary across jurisdictions (Friendly et al., 2020), participants were asked to react in accordance with exactly how these groups were specified within their jurisdiction. Thus, comparisons throughout districts or territories are challenging to interpret because the very same small categories may represent various age ranges.


Qualities of child treatment centres consisted of whether they offered kids of a given group, whether they were accredited by day care authorities, and auspice (private not-for-profit lawful condition or government-operated, personal for-profit). Information was additionally collected on five kinds of care choices, including (1) permanent; (2) part-time; (3) before or after college; (4) throughout evenings, on weekend breaks or overnight; and (5) on a drop-in or flexible basis.


Further, the survey recorded the full time everyday fee per youngster see it here (including aids) charged by centres, by group. National fee price quotes were restricted to centres supplying permanent treatment alternatives and operating outside the district of Quebec. preschools near me. Estimates on the enrolment of children with aids were also limited to regions outside Quebec

Supervisors were included in personnel matters because they may likewise have treatment responsibilities. Overdue pupils and volunteers, sustain personnel, or employees on leave were excluded. https://hearthis.at/happylandccc/set/happyland-childcare-learning-centre/. To characterize the education and learning and training account of centre team, the ratio of total amount (complete- and part-time) staff with an ECE certification at the diploma or certificate level (one to three years of postsecondary training) or higher (four-year level or grad training) to complete team was obtained


Centre supervisors and drivers further reported whether they satisfied rural and territorial requirements for personnel certifications. Responses included whether the centre (a) surpassed provincial and territorial requirements for the variety of ECE personnel, (b) fulfilled the needs, (c) had permission to operate with fewer ECE-qualified staff than needed or (d) had actually lowered the variety of spaces ran due to an inability to meet needs.




Adverse impacts associated with COVID-19 experienced in the year before the interview were reported, including lower enrolment or fewer kids, problem recruiting and keeping competent day care workers, loss of workers as a result of COVID-19-related health and wellness worries, lost or decreased government funding, deferred rent on business space, expenses connected particularly with COVID-19 health and wellness needs, trouble keeping government guidelines connected with COVID-19 health and wellness needs, temporary closure of service, previous or continuous loss of income, and various other influences. Detailed analyses taken a look at general centre qualities, services provided, enrolment, team, credentials and pay at the nationwide level. To decrease bias in mean estimates associated with implausibly high values (outliers), counts relating to enrolment, staffing and charges at or over the 99th percentile were omitted. Mean counts were computed just in qualified centres that supplied the corresponding forms of care.

Cross-tabulations between descriptive characteristics of youngster treatment centres and selected effect indications were made, and between-group differences were checked out utilizing unpaired t-tests. Distinctions between the attributes of youngster care centres that experienced better versus lesser effects due to COVID-19 might offer understanding right into the prospective results of the COVID-19 pandemic on the provision of day care services.


Analyses were executed in SAS Enterprise Guide 8.3 making use of G-estimation macros (G-Est 2.03.004) for domain and variance estimate (Data copyright, 2022d). There were an estimated 12,664 youngster treatment centres across copyright giving treatment to kids aged 0 to 5 years in April 2022 (see Chart 1 for provincial and territorial quotes).
